If you have any credit cards, addresses, or other information saved in Firefox, copy them manually into 1Password. Open 1Password on your computer or mobile device and click the button to add items. To prevent Firefox from interfering with 1Password, make sure you have the 1Password browser extension installed , then turn off the built-in password manager in Firefox.

You want to use different passwords for every website, but it can be hard to keep track of them all. With 1Password you only ever need to memorize…one password. All your other passwords and important information are protected behind the one password only you know. The data you save is encrypted and inaccessible to us, including so called metadata like titles, website URLs, tags, and custom icons.
